2019 smart EQ ForTwo review
This is my third Smart electric. I leased a 2013 and a 2016 electric (if I bought either, I would have had to continue leasing the battery, which didn't make sense for me). I leased a 2019 electric and, since they've stopped selling the Smart in the US, I've decided to buy this one (which comes with the battery - yay!). I love the Smart for its utter cuteness and tininess. It has like a zero degree turning radius, and I'm able to zip in and out of anywhere. It's perfect for my needs, as I tend to do mostly local driving, and I occasionally take it on the freeway if the drive isn't too long. With regenerative braking, I usually get at least 80 miles with each full charge. The only issues I've had with this car are (1) when I first picked it up, it died on me within the first week, and it took the dealer 28 days to reboot and fix everything, and (2) the cup holders aren't adjustable, so my big water bottle doesn't fit (my other Smarts had adjustable holders, so why did they change this?). After driving Smarts for 9 years, I can't really drive other cars -- they all seem so huge and cumbersome. But for longer drives, I do borrow my husband's EV, which has a longer range. I did consider at some point getting a Fiat electric and test-drove one, but it just wasn't as cute as the Smart. Its adorableness makes me happy every time I come out of a building and see it waiting for me. Even after driving it for 3 years, its cuteness still sometimes takes me by surprise!

2019 smart EQ ForTwo review
I have not had to buy gasoline to commute for the last five years. It is unfortunate that Smart has withdrawn from the North American car market. I have owned a 2013 Smart ED and currently have a 2017 Smart ForTwo ED Passion coupe and just picked up the 2019 Smart ForTwo EQ Prime Cabrio. These cars are fun to drive, perfect urban, and suburban commuter car. Long trips take some planning but are quite do able. Published EPA mileage is way below reality. I average 70+ Miles per charge. Best mileage achievement was 129 miles between charges.

What is the electric range of the smart EQ ForTwo?
The electric smart EQ ForTwo can travel up to 58 miles on a single charge depending on electric motor and battery options.
EPA-estimated range is the distance, or predicted distance, a new plug-in vehicle will travel on electric power before its battery charge is exhausted. Actual range will vary depending on model year, driving conditions, driving habits, elevation changes, weather, accessory usage (lights, climate control), vehicle condition and other factors.
